Same problem, but with a 2940U2W scsi board.
Never tried 2.4.0 but I tried old and new AIC driver with no succes
Both in UP, UP+APIC and SMP kernel (2.4.4-acx and 2.4.5+).
You have more luck than me: removing all other boards in my box
change nothing.
My motherboard is an old asus P/I-P65UP5/C-P55T2D (bi p5 233MMX
430HX chipset)
Fortunately my old 2940UW still works flawlessly.
